Gotye – Somebody That I Used To Know Lyrics 14 years ago
This song is basically about two different relationships, one in the past and one in the present, let me explain:

"Now and then I think of when we were together, like when you said you felt so happy you could die. I told myself that you were right for me, but felt so lonely in your company but that was love and it's an ache I still remember."

- It follows a guy who every now and then thinks of his old relationship with an ex-girfriend. He's remembering when she told him she was so incredibly happy and he told himself that she was right for him. It sounded like he realized that he sort of forced his feelings for her because he was telling himself that she was right, he didn't necessarily feel it. However, even though he told himself he was happy there was always a part of himself that felt distant from her. However, he thought what they had was true love and regardless of whether or not it was it's something he still continues to remember and feel.

"You can get addicted to a certain kind'a sadness, like resignation to the end, always the end. So when we found that we could not make sense, well you said that we would still be friends but I'll admit that I was glad it was over."

- Here, the guy is describing the end of the relationship, how he knew it was ending but even a deteriorating relationship was better than none at all. It's like ripping off a band aid. The resignation of relationships is typically, in this case, when the worst has happened and there is no other choice but to give up. The guy and his ex-girlfriend realized they didn't fit together like they thought they had and she offered friendship in place of the relationship, he sadly admitted he was glad it was over because it was such a heavy burden on him.

"But you didn't have to cut me off, make out like it never happened and that we were nothing. I don't even need your love, but you treat me like a stranger and that feels so rough."

- The guy is now upset because after the relationship ended there really wasn't a friendship. In fact, the ex-girlfriend treated him like a stranger if they ever ran into one another. Here the guy is angrily admitting he didn't need her love to go on and that he did want them to end on a better note, however, she didn't and it bothers him.

"No, you didn't have to stoop so low, have your friends collect your records and then change your number. Guess that I don't need that though now you're just somebody that I used to know."

- Here, the guy could be saying she is acting childish about their relationship ending by going to the lengths of taking back all of her things and changing her number. He realizes he doesn't need these little things because she isn't the same person he knew and loved, she's just somebody that he used to know (like a grocerer, no one special).

Now, here is where the present girlfriend (Kimbra) is speaking.

"Now and then I think of all the times you screwed me over but had me believin' it was always something that I'd done."

The guy from the beginning is now in a new relationship with a different girl. This girl is thinking of all the times he'd wrong her, in little ways, by maybe comparing her and his ex or maybe he's reacted a certain to something. She had always blamed herself for the problems or misunderstandings in their present relationship.

"But I don't wanna live that way, reading into every word you say. You said you could let it go, and I wouldn't catch you hung up on somebody that you used to know."

- Here is the most powerful part of the song. The girlfriend is admitting she doesn't want to have the relationship they do, she isn't happy with what they have. She hates having to be extra cautious of what he says, hoping it somehow doesn't relate to his ex-girlfriend. She is unsure of his true feelings for her and his true feelings for his ex-girlfriend. She reminds him of his promise to her, telling her he was finished what what he had but she catches him (not physically) but emotionally that he is still hung up on his ex-girlfriend, the somebody that he used to know.

The rest of the song repeats the chorus and the male repeating the line: "Somebody that I used to know."

After the girlfriend finished her part, I believe she left the relationship knowing that he was never going to get over his ex-girlfriend and she didn't want to be a shell for that. The guy is left pondering on his ex-girlfriend.

Now, Gotye did say the song is about the guy and his ex-girlfriend arguing back and forth in the song but I see this way makes more sense to me since I totally understand the scenario I wrote out and it seems a far sadder realm.

Bonnie Raitt – I Can't Make You Love Me Lyrics 14 years ago
I don't believe the song is only past tense, I believe it could be present tense. To me, the song is about a boy and girl in a very caring relationship, but the girl is hopelessly in love with him and she clearly knows he doesn't love her, he hasn't reached that understanding yet. To break it down:

"Turn down the lights, turn down the bed, turn down these voices inside my head, lay down with me. Tell me no lies, just hold me close, don't patronize, don't patronize me."

- Right here, in the girls aspect, she's saying let's just lay here together, in each others arms. Be completely open and honest with me. The voices in her head are doubt or worry and she is turning them down because she hates the worry of him never loving her or feeling the same way. She just wants to endure him and he to her.

"Cause I can't make you love me if you don't, you can't make your heart feel something it won't. Here in the dark, in these final hours I will lay down my heart and I will feel the power. But you won't, no you won't cause I can't make you love me."

- However, she knows no matter what she does she can't force him to love her, and you can't make herself have feelings or love for another, they just are. The part about being in the dark, I feel, in complete and total vulnerability. By laying down her heart, she is completely letting her emotions take over her and let him feel the fullest extent of her love and she will embrace it. However, she knows he won't do the same because he doesn't love her that way and she can't make him.

"I'll close my eyes, then I won't see the love you don't feel when you're holding me. Morning will come and I'll do what's right. Just give me till then to give up this fight and I will give up this fight."

- By closing her eyes, it could mean physically closing her eyes or shutting away her intense feelings for the time being. I believe it's physical and she might rest her head on his chest because she doesn't want to see for herself that even though he is holding her so lovingly and warm, he doesn't love her. He cares and adores her but he doesn't love her yet and yet she holds him with everything she has. However, when the next day comes and she wakes up she knows what she has to do. The fight is her feelings battling his own. She knows she has to stop trying to force his love in even the smallest ways. That the only true love is his decision to love her back. She will still love him but knows that the fighting and battling of her emotions and even trying to manipulate his are wrong and untrue.
